  • How to Apply Construction Adhesive Like a Professional

    Using construction adhesive effectively can make a significant difference in the strength and durability of your projects, whether you’re working on flooring, cabinetry, or other home improvements. Applying adhesive like a professional involves not only choosing the right product but also using the proper techniques for application. This guide will walk you through the steps to apply construction adhesive effectively, ensuring a strong bond.

    1. Choose the Right Type of Construction Adhesive

    Before you begin, it’s crucial to select the appropriate type of construction adhesive for your specific project. Different adhesives are formulated for various materials and applications. Some common types include:

    1.1. Polyurethane Adhesive

    Ideal for bonding wood, metal, and masonry, polyurethane adhesive is waterproof and provides a strong, flexible bond.

    1.2. PVA (Polyvinyl Acetate) Adhesive

    Often used for woodworking and craft projects, PVA adhesive is easy to work with and cleans up with water. However, it’s not waterproof.

    1.3. Silicone Adhesive

    Best for flexible applications, silicone adhesive is waterproof and can bond various materials, including glass and ceramics.

    1.4. Construction-Grade Adhesive

    These adhesives are designed for heavy-duty applications and can bond a wide variety of materials, making them suitable for most construction projects.

    3. Prepare the Surface

    Proper surface preparation is essential for achieving a strong bond:

    3.1. Clean the Surfaces

    Remove any dust, dirt, grease, or old adhesive from the surfaces you plan to bond. Use a clean cloth and a suitable cleaner, if necessary, to ensure the surfaces are clean and dry.

    3.2. Ensure Alignment

    If you’re bonding two pieces together, make sure they are aligned correctly before applying the adhesive. This will help you avoid the need for adjustments after the adhesive is applied.

    4. Cut the Adhesive Tube

    If you’re using a tube of construction adhesive, you’ll need to cut the tip of the tube to allow the adhesive to flow out:

    1. Cut the Tip: Use a utility knife to cut the tip of the adhesive tube at a 45-degree angle. The size of the hole will determine the bead size; a larger hole will yield a thicker bead.
    2. Puncture the Seal: Use a long nail or the built-in puncture tool on the caulking gun to puncture the inner seal of the tube.

    5. Load the Caulking Gun

    Once the tube is prepared, load it into the caulking gun:

    1. Insert the Tube: Place the adhesive tube into the caulking gun, ensuring it is seated properly.
    2. Advance the Plunger: Squeeze the trigger of the caulking gun to advance the plunger and hold the tube securely in place.

    6. Apply the Adhesive

    Now it’s time to apply the adhesive:

    6.1. Use Steady Pressure

    Position the tip of the tube where you want to apply the adhesive. Squeeze the trigger steadily to dispense a continuous bead of adhesive along the surface. The bead should be approximately 1/4 inch thick for most applications, but this can vary based on your project.

    6.2. Move at a Steady Pace

    Keep the gun moving at a steady pace to ensure an even application. For larger surfaces, you may need to apply the adhesive in sections.

    6.3. Use Patterns for Large Areas

    For large areas, consider applying the adhesive in a zigzag or wavy pattern to maximize coverage. This will help ensure that the adhesive spreads evenly over the surface.

    7. Press and Secure the Materials

    After applying the adhesive, press the surfaces together firmly. Make sure to align them properly and apply even pressure across the entire surface. If necessary, use clamps or weights to hold the materials in place while the adhesive cures.

    8. Clean Up Excess Adhesive

    As the adhesive begins to set, clean up any excess that squeezes out from the joint:

    1. Use a Clean Cloth: Wipe away excess adhesive with a clean cloth before it dries. This will make for a neater finish and prevent any unwanted residue.
    2. Follow Manufacturer Instructions: Check the adhesive packaging for specific cleanup instructions, including recommendations for solvents if needed.

    9. Allow for Curing Time

    After securing the materials, allow the adhesive to cure according to the manufacturer’s instructions. Curing times can vary significantly depending on the type of adhesive used and environmental conditions.

    10. Test the Bond

    Once the adhesive has fully cured, test the bond by gently applying pressure to the joined surfaces. If everything feels secure, you’ve successfully applied your construction adhesive like a professional!
